Why is wall thickness important in 3D printing?
AIt determines the printer's power consumption
BIt affects the strength and durability of the printed object
CIt controls the color of the print
DIt sets the printing speed
Step-by-Step Solution
Solution:
  1. Step 1: Identify the role of wall thickness

    Wall thickness determines how strong and durable the printed object will be.
  2. Step 2: Exclude unrelated effects

    Color, power consumption, and speed are not directly controlled by wall thickness.
  3. Final Answer:

    It affects the strength and durability of the printed object -> Option B
  4. Quick Check:

    Wall thickness = Strength factor [OK]
Quick Trick: Thicker walls mean stronger prints, not color or speed. [OK]
